📅  最后修改于: 2023-12-03 15:37:18.095000             🧑  作者: Mango
在 API 开发中,需要使用变量来存储数据,而有时候这些变量只在当前函数或方法中使用,这时可以考虑定义局部变量,以便在程序的其余部分不被访问或更改。
在许多编程语言中,定义局部变量需要使用特定关键字和语法。例如,在 JavaScript 中,可以使用 let
或 const
关键字定义局部变量。在 Python 中,使用冒号和缩进来定义块,并将变量赋值在该块中,定义局部变量。
以下是一个使用 JavaScript 定义局部变量的示例:
function calculateArea(radius) {
const pi = 3.14; // 定义局部变量 pi
let area = pi * radius * radius; // 定义局部变量 area
return area;
}
在此示例中,pi
和 area
变量仅在 calculateArea()
函数中使用,并在函数执行完毕后被销毁。这有助于确保程序的安全性和可靠性。
在 API 中定义局部变量可以提高代码的模块性和可读性,并防止对变量的意外更改或访问。因此,当您需要定义仅在特定函数或方法中使用的变量时,请考虑使用局部变量来实现。
参考文献: